 After the tragic incident with the catfish, Manti Te'o found true love in the form of Jovi, his recent wife. The footballer and former Notre Dame star married his longtime girlfriend Jovi Nicole Engbino at an oceanfront ceremony in La Jolla, California. He posted photos on his Instagram revealing the wedding on Monday, August 31, 2020. In 2012, Te'o made national headlines when he revealed that he had once been in a relationship with Lennay Kekua, but in turn, it was revealed that the girl had already died after the fight with leukemia. Te'o revealed that his grandmother and girlfriend both died the same year.

He was traumatized and ultimately could not be successful with the project this year. He said the infamous catfish fishing probably caused him to lose in the first round of the draft. However, he was selected in the second round. That would make him millions. Now Manti and Jovi are the parents of the lovely daughter Hiromi, who was born in August 2021. Manti is a famous football star who has worked with teams such as the San Diego Chargers, New Orleans Saints, and the Chicago Bears during his time with the NFL.
